Red Dead Redemption 2, another game widely considered one of the best of its generation, is a masterclass in world-building. Rockstar Games took open-world gaming to a new level with the expansive and alive world of the American frontier. Players experience the life of Arthur Morgan and his gang in ways that feel authentic, detailed, and genuinely immersive. The world itself feels like a living, breathing entity, with characters, animals, and environmental storytelling all working together to make the setting as real as possible. Few games have captured the essence of a time period and the raw emotions of its characters in such an unforgettable way.
Lastly, The Legend of Zelda: Breath of the Wild has fundamentally changed how players think about exploration in open-world games. Unlike many games that fill their maps with markers and objectives, Breath of the Wild gives players the freedom to explore the vast world without feeling constrained. The lack of hand-holding allows for personal discovery, making every mountain climb or new location feel earned. The game’s physics engine, which allows for creativity in solving problems, and its open-ended approach to combat and puzzle-solving are just a few reasons why it is considered one of the best games ever made.
